District Overview

Savoy School District is a public school district serving Savoy area, Massachusetts. For academic year 2020-2021, 1 schools served 52 students through PK to 06th grade in its 1 schools. A total of 4 teachers are teaching their students and the average students to teacher ratio is 13 to 1.

According to the Massachusetts state assessment result, 0% of students are proficient in Math learning and about 49% of students are proficient in English/language arts learning.

Teachers & Staffs

Total 4 full-time (or equivalent) teachers work for schools in Savoy School District and the students to teacher ratio is 13 to 1. All teachers are certified. 75.0% of teachers have 3 or more years teaching experiences.
